The automated assignment and scheduling of follow-up meetings, classes, or mentoring sessions along a believer's spiritual growth path, ensuring consistent progression.

Definition & Meaning

Discipleship Routing in PastorAgenda streamlines the journey from new believer to mature disciple by automatically scheduling next steps based on milestones. For instance, after baptism, the system schedules a foundational class and assigns a mentor. This reduces administrative burden on pastors and ensures no one falls through the cracks. Strategic routing increases engagement and retention, as members experience a clear growth trajectory. Real-world impact includes higher participation in small groups and more intentional spiritual development. PastorAgenda's workflow engine customizes routes for different demographics.
